| To rent a car in Barbados, you must obtain a local visitor driving permit, which can be acquired from the Barbados Licensing Authority or authorised car rental companies. Ensure you have a valid driver's licence from your country of residence and meet the minimum age requirement of 21 years. |
| Driving in Barbados is on the left-hand side of the road, which may require adjustment for visitors from countries with right-hand driving. Be particularly cautious at roundabouts and intersections, and always yield to traffic coming from the right. |
| While main roads are generally in good condition, some rural roads can be narrow and less maintained. Drive cautiously, especially when exploring less developed areas, and be prepared for occasional potholes or uneven surfaces. |
| Fuel stations are readily available throughout the island, but it's advisable to keep your tank adequately filled, especially when venturing into more remote areas. Note that some stations may only accept cash, so carrying local currency is recommended. |
A compact or mid-sized car is ideal for navigating the roads around Dover and the broader island of Barbados. These vehicles offer ease of parking in popular areas like St. Lawrence Gap and are suitable for the island's road conditions, which can vary from well-paved highways to narrower rural roads.
Parking in Dover and the surrounding areas is generally accessible, with free street parking available near popular spots like Dover Beach and St. Lawrence Gap. However, during peak tourist seasons or events like the Oistins Fish Fry, parking spaces can become limited, so it's advisable to arrive early or consider alternative transportation options.
In Barbados, the maximum speed limits are 60 km/h (37 mph) on highways and 40 km/h (25 mph) in urban areas. It's important to adhere to these limits and be cautious of pedestrians and local traffic patterns, especially in bustling areas like St. Lawrence Gap and Oistins.
| Dover Beach: A pristine stretch of white sand known for its calm waters suitable for swimming and various water sports, including Hobie Cat sailing and windsurfing. The beach is equipped with amenities like beach chair rentals, restrooms, and nearby eateries. |
| St. Lawrence Gap: Often referred to as 'The Gap,' this lively area is the epicentre of Barbados' nightlife, featuring a 1.5-kilometre stretch of bars, restaurants, dance clubs, and shops along a picturesque beachfront. |
| Oistins Fish Fry: A vibrant weekly event held every Friday evening in the nearby fishing town of Oistins, where visitors can enjoy freshly grilled seafood, live music, and dancing, offering an authentic taste of Bajan culture. |
| Christ Church Parish Church: A historic church dating back to 1935, known for the mysterious Chase Vault, where coffins were reportedly found displaced without explanation. Visitors can explore the churchyard and delve into the intriguing tales of this site. |
| Flower Forest: A 50-acre botanical garden located near the village of Bloomsbury, Saint Joseph, featuring collections of heliconias, ginger lilies, bromeliads, and other tropical flowers beneath tall Caribbean Royal palms. |
| Bridgetown: The capital city of Barbados, approximately a 15-minute drive from Dover, offering duty-free shopping, jewellery stores, and various fashion outlets. |
| Graeme Hall Nature Sanctuary: A tranquil escape just a short drive from Dover Beach, this protected area is home to diverse bird species and tropical flora, making it a paradise for nature lovers and birdwatchers. |
